Importance of Regular Maintenance
Regular maintenance of your septic system is essential to ensure optimal performance and longevity. By implementing preventative measures through regular inspections and pumping, you can avoid costly repairs and extend the lifespan of your septic tank. Regular maintenance involves monitoring the levels of sludge and scum in the tank, as well as checking for any leaks or signs of damage. Neglecting maintenance can lead to system failures, backups, and potential environmental contamination.
Taking care of your septic system not only benefits you financially but also has a positive environmental impact. Proper maintenance helps prevent harmful pathogens and chemicals from leaching into the soil and groundwater, protecting the surrounding ecosystem. Risks of DIY Cleaning
Attempting to clean your septic tank yourself poses significant risks that can compromise its functionality and lead to potential hazards. The use of improper techniques during the cleaning process can result in serious issues that may be costly to rectify.
Here are some risks associated with DIY septic tank cleaning:
- Contamination: Accidental spills or leaks while cleaning the septic tank can lead to contamination of the surrounding soil and groundwater.
- System Damage: Using harsh chemicals or tools incorrectly can damage the septic system components, leading to malfunctions or failures.
- Health Risks: Exposure to toxic fumes or pathogens present in the septic tank can pose health risks to you and your family.

How Often Should a Septic Tank Be Inspected for Potential Issues?
Inspect your septic tank regularly to catch potential issues early. Frequency depends on usage, but typically every 1-3 years. Maintenance schedules keep your system running smoothly and prevent costly repairs. Stay proactive for peace of mind.
Are There Any Specific Signs Homeowners Should Look Out for That Indicate a Need for Professional Septic Tank Cleaning?
When signs like slow drains, foul odors, or sewage backups appear, it's crucial to act swiftly. Ignoring these indicators may lead to costly repairs. Professional septic tank cleaning prevents major issues, ensures system efficiency, and safeguards your property.
What Are Some Common Misconceptions About Septic Tank Maintenance That Homeowners Should Be Aware Of?
Common misconceptions about septic tank maintenance include thinking additives replace pumping, or that tanks never need cleaning. Proper maintenance involves regular pumping, avoiding chemicals, and being alert to signs of trouble.
